Ontario Association of the Deaf Ontario Association of the Deaf (OAD) is Canada's oldest Deaf non-profit consumer organization. OAD is working for the purpose of ensuring equality and protecting the rights of Deaf Ontarians. OAD was founded in 1886 by two Deaf instructors from the Belleville Institution for the Deaf, then Ontario School of the Deaf then now known as Sir James Whitney. OAD depends on both public donations and government funding for our operations. The organization was incorporated in 1963.
